Inclusion Criteria

Arrhythmia patients with electrocardiogram records, electrophysiological tests, and arrhythmia resection records in INHA university hospital.
1)paroxysmal supraventricular tachycardia(PSVT): Normal sinus rhythm and tachycardia in patients with atrioventricular nodular regression tachycardia and atrioventricular regression tachycardia by electrophysiological examination and arrhythmia resection

2)Wolf-Parkinson-White Syndrome (WPW): WPW electrocardiogram in patients with proven parenteral insufficiency by electrophysiological examination and arrhythmia resection

3)Ventricular premature contraction (PVC): Electrical physiology and arrhythmia resection with ventricular premature contraction (PVC) including early contraction in patients with proven location of ventricular premature contraction

4)Ventricular tachycardia (VT): An electrophysiological examination and arrhythmia resection were performed with ventricular tachycardia (VT) to prove the location of ventricular tachycardia

Exclusion Criteria

The above study is a data collection study using electrocardiogram, and there are no exclusion criteria other than patients who are unsuitable as subjects according to the researcher's judgment

Primary Outcome Measures
NameTimeMethod
Development of an electrocardiogram prediction program using a 12-lead electrocardiogram artificial intelligence algorithm by encrypting and extracting raw data from cardiovascular disease patients
Secondary Outcome Measures
NameTimeMethod
(Developed AI-based electrocardiogram prediction program) Interpreting 12-lead ECG using AI provides important clues to the preparation and execution of resection procedures for WPW syndrome, PVC and VT, helping EP professionals in safety and efficiency
